Overview

A fun read-aloud that teaches kids about their bodies while searching for the ever-elusive belly button. I can find my eyes I can find my nose I can find my fingers And can find my toes I cannot find my belly button There's a hole where it goes! Follow along with this playful read-aloud as a child looks everywhere for their belly button but can't seem to find it! Until big sister comes to reveal the big secret: some are ""innies"" and some are ""outies""! I Cannot Find My Belly Button is a great way to practice naming all of the parts of the body while having some silly, rhyming fun.

Author Information

Eva Treistman has had a passion for storytelling and rhyme since she could speak. She has published various poems in Highlights on the road to caring for her father with Alzheimer's and having her own special needs child, and she has finally arrived in a place where she can focus on publishing. Eva lives with her husband, Greg, daughter Zoe and cat Xerxes, on a lake at the top of a mountain where NJ meets NY, oh so close to Pennsylvania - a true ""tristate"" resident.
